# The Rise of Artificial Intelligence in Behavioral Finance

Artificial Intelligence (AI) is revolutionizing behavioral finance by providing deeper insights into market psychology. Advanced algorithms can now analyze vast amounts of data to identify patterns and predict market behavior with unprecedented accuracy. For instance, AI-driven tools can monitor social media sentiment to gauge investor moods, which can be a leading indicator of market trends. This integration of AI in behavioral finance enhances decision-making processes, making them more data-driven and less prone to emotional biases.

# The Impact of Neuroeconomics on Financial Decision-Making

Neuroeconomics, the interdisciplinary field that combines neuroscience, economics, and psychology, is making waves in behavioral finance. By studying how the brain processes financial decisions, neuroeconomics provides a deeper understanding of why investors make certain choices. This knowledge can be leveraged to develop more effective financial strategies and risk management techniques.

For example, neuroeconomic research has shown that the brain's reward system plays a crucial role in investment decisions. Understanding this can help in creating financial products that are more aligned with human psychology, thereby increasing their adoption and success rates. # Sustainable Investing and Behavioral Finance

Sustainable investing, which focuses on environmental, social, and governance (ESG) factors, is gaining traction in the financial world. Behavioral finance plays a critical role in this area by helping investors understand the psychological motivations behind sustainable investing. For instance, many investors are driven by a desire to make a positive impact on society, which can be harnessed to create more sustainable financial products.

Innovations in behavioral finance are also helping to address the challenges of sustainable investing, such as the perceived trade-off between financial returns and sustainability goals. By understanding the behavioral biases that influence investment decisions, professionals can develop strategies that align financial goals with sustainability objectives.
